Wall-mounted fixtures

Wall-mounted fixtures are another great way to save space and create a more spacious feel in a small bathroom. Wall-mounted vanities, sinks, and toilets are all popular options.

Wall-mounted vanities can be installed at a height that is comfortable for you, which can be especially helpful for people with limited mobility. They also make it easier to clean the floor beneath the vanity.

Wall-mounted sinks are also a good option for small bathrooms. They can be installed in a variety of shapes and sizes, so you can find one that fits your needs and style. Wall-mounted sinks can also be paired with a floating vanity or a countertop that is supported by brackets.

Finally, wall-mounted toilets are a great way to save space and add a touch of luxury to your bathroom. Wall-mounted toilets are typically more expensive than traditional toilets, but they can be a worthwhile investment if you have a small bathroom.

Recessed niches

Recessed niches are a great way to add storage space and visual interest to a small bathroom. Niches can be built into the wall or created using shelves or cabinets.

Recessed niches can be used to store a variety of items, such as toiletries, towels, and decorative objects. They can also be used to create a display for your favorite pieces of art or pottery.

If you have a small shower, you can consider installing a recessed niche for your shampoo, conditioner, and other shower essentials. This can help to keep your shower organized and clutter-free.

Recessed niches can also be used to create a more spacious feel in a small bathroom. By adding niches to the walls, you can break up the monotony of a flat surface and create a more dynamic and interesting space.

When designing recessed niches for your small bathroom, be sure to consider the following:

  • Size: The size of your niches will depend on the items you plan to store in them. Be sure to choose niches that are large enough to accommodate your needs.
  • Location: The location of your niches is also important. Be sure to place them in a convenient location where you can easily reach them.
  • Materials: You can choose from a variety of materials for your niches, such as tile, stone, or glass. Be sure to choose a material that is durable and easy to clean.

Natural materials

Natural materials are a great way to add warmth and texture to a small bathroom.

  • Wood: Wood is a classic choice for bathroom vanities, cabinets, and flooring. It adds a touch of warmth and elegance to any space.
  • Stone: Stone is another popular choice for bathroom countertops, tiles, and shower surrounds. It is durable and easy to clean, and it comes in a variety of colors and styles.
  • Bamboo: Bamboo is a sustainable and eco-friendly choice for bathroom flooring and countertops. It is also very durable and easy to maintain.
  • Cork: Cork is a warm and inviting material that can be used for bathroom flooring and wall tiles. It is also naturally water-resistant and easy to clean.

When using natural materials in a small bathroom, it is important to keep the following in mind:

  • Sealing: Be sure to seal natural materials properly to protect them from water damage.
  • Maintenance: Natural materials may require more maintenance than other materials. For example, wood floors need to be refinished periodically.
  • Cost: Natural materials can be more expensive than other materials. However, they can also add value to your home.

Accessible design

Accessible design is important for creating bathrooms that are safe and easy to use for people of all abilities.

When designing an accessible bathroom, it is important to consider the following:

  • Clear pathways: There should be clear pathways to all fixtures and features in the bathroom. This means that there should be enough space for a wheelchair or walker to move around comfortably.
  • Grab bars: Grab bars should be installed near the toilet, shower, and bathtub. Grab bars can help people to get in and out of the shower or bathtub safely.
  • Curbless shower: A curbless shower is a shower that does not have a raised threshold. This makes it easier for people with disabilities to enter and exit the shower.
  • Raised toilet seat: A raised toilet seat can make it easier for people with disabilities to sit down and stand up from the toilet.

In addition to these specific features, there are a number of other things you can do to make your bathroom more accessible. For example, you can choose fixtures that are easy to reach and use, and you can avoid using sharp or pointed edges.
